Hi All,

Just a small update today. Thanks to Alan and Martyn for your advice on the flags. I much prefer them like this, they look more realistic.

http://forum.model-space...sts&t=6314&p=27

I fitted the flags to their threads and mixed a 50/50 solution of white glue and water. I gently folded the flags in an attempt to make their appearance more realistic. Once done, I painted them with the white glue solution and used some hair clips to help maintain their shape. Some look better than others. But, once they are flying they should look the part.

I applied the decals and NO, NO NOCursing Cursing Cursing , when I looked again it had fallen off!!! I will have to sort this out later.

On a happier note, I fitted the small boats. I left the rudders on the Barge, Pinnace & cutter. I now this is incorrect, as they would have been stowed safely, but I think they look nice.
